Be careful, last winter I was contacted by a new member that I was helping in a thread and I was set up :angry7: took advatage of my dumb Arkansas mind I guess :-D
He did not have the correct Carb for his slant and I sold my carb that came off Victoria
I guess I was to gullible and sent it to him so he could get it going never herd from him again and never got paid. I learned a big lesson that day...
I think I even seen it on E-bay for sale. New members will just have to wait till I get paid before I ship anything, once bitten twice shy 8)
